DataStax CQL v3.3 document on now() function here (http://docs.datastax.com/en/cql/3.3/cql/cql_reference/timeuuid_functions_r.html) states that it is generated on the coordinator, but this is not reflected on the apache cassandra CQL3 spec. Since it is a minor addition, there's no urgency to add it and the commit can stay in trunk.
